In two projects on our Jira installation, the issue sequence number jumps by 10s, 100s, or even thousands. For example:
* TTC-25, TTC-124
* TTC-192, 721, 2194, 2195, 3654

I disabled the Gantt Chart for Jira version 3.1.1-JIRA5 after reading the issue below, and the number now no longer jumps. Is there a fix for this so that the Gantt Chart Plugin can be used?
